US economy expanded at solid 2.1% pace in January-March, government says, upgrading last estimate

The U.S. economy expanded at a solid and unexpected 2.1% annual pace from January through March, the Commerce Department reported Thursday in its final estimate of first-quarter growth.The growth in gross domestic product — the nation’s output of goods and services — marked a rebound from a slugg...

Why this matters in The Piney Point
For Piney Point Village residents, the upgraded estimate of the US economy's growth rate may have implications for local business investment, particularly in the technology sector. The surge in business investment, driven in part by the artificial intelligence boom, could lead to increased economic activity in the Houston area, where many tech companies have a presence. However, the decline in consumer spending, potentially due to higher gasoline prices, may affect local retailers and small businesses that rely on consumer discretionary spending. As the US and Iran continue talks towards a resolution, residents of Piney Point Village will be watching to see how the conflict affects the local economy, particularly in terms of energy prices and consumer confidence. The growth in federal government spending and investment may also have a ripple effect on the local economy, potentially leading to increased demand for goods and services in the area.
